noun
- a person who apologizes or makes excuses for something
Examples
- She’s always been an apologizer, saying sorry even when it’s not her fault.
- The company hired a professional apologizer to handle the public relations crisis.
- He’s such an apologizer that people don’t take his apologies seriously anymore.
- The politician was known as an apologizer for his party’s controversial policies.
- Don’t be an apologizer for other people’s bad behavior.
- The apologizer spent the entire meeting making excuses for the team’s poor performance.
